Pattern adjustments

https://www.aytoyuncler.com/2023/09/14/nhyw0iim6r5 I actually made quite a few mods to this jacket.

  • Brought in shoulders 1″
  • Lengthened sleeves 1 1/2″
  • Widened welt pockets 1/2″
  • Added shaping by bringing in the sides about an 1″ at the waist

https://elartedemedir.com/blog/7m0smtxca You can see from the photo below how I widened the welt pockets and brought in the sides. The red markings are my adjustments.

https://aguasdeburgos.com/dld32bo9x

https://culturviajes.org/2023/09/14/2t4v2o37an1 This jean jacket pattern is pretty boxy to begin with and still is even after a bit of waist shaping. I am glad I brought it in a touch and probably could have even more!

https://artesaniadelapalma.com/u7if6nz I didn’t lengthen this pattern at all, which I usually do since I am tall (5’10”), but I really wanted a jean jacket to wear with dresses, so I felt like the length was in a nice place to be able to wear it with a variety of things. Cara’s jacket is lengthened for reference. Since I wasn’t adding length, I felt like the eight buttons in the pattern image looked a bit excessive and opted for six buttons on the front instead.

Construction notes

https://acatfcl.cat/1014cig4 The Seamwork Audrey and the Hampton Jean Jacket are very similar patterns, so while I mostly followed Seamwork’s Sew a Denim Jacket class videos to construct this jacket, I did refer to the Hampton Jean Jacket Sewalong in some places. I liked the way the collar was constructed on the Hampton Jean Jacket better, so I followed their tutorial instead. I also referred to the Hampton Jean Jacket sewalong to add functional front pockets. A pocket lining is needed to do that, so I just ended up using my tried and true Negroni pocket variation as a base and that worked pretty well!

Fit

https://www.a-crear.com/rd2tyljwc3u So after all of those adjustments, how do I feel about the fit? Buttoned, this jacket fits pretty well around the waist, but I probably could have take a couple of inches out of the back. The only other thing I would change next time would be to move the welt pockets forward a touch. They just feel a bit too far back when I go to put my hands in them. Other than that this jacket is pretty perfect. Compared to the ready-to-wear jean jackets I have owned in the past, this is a huge improvement!
